Authorship and Creation
Here Comes the Navy's producer is recorded as Hal B. Wallis[28]. Its director is recorded as Lloyd Bacon[5]. Screenwriters include Earl Baldwin[6] and Alfred A. Cohn[7]. Cast members include James Cagney[13], Gloria Stuart[14], Pat O'Brien[15], Frank McHugh[16], Robert Barrat[17], and George Irving[18].
Publication
Here Comes the Navy's publication date is recorded as +1934-01-01T00:00:00Z[29]. Its original language of film or TV show is recorded as English[30]. Genres include romantic comedy[9], buddy film[10], comedy drama[11], and drama film[12].
Subject and Themes
Here Comes the Navy's main subject is recorded as aviation[31].
